A central air conditioner cools air in one area before dispersing it throughout the home using the heater’s air handling capabilities. This sets it apart from window or wall air conditioners or mini-split systems, which all chill relatively tiny areas and need numerous units to cool the entire home.
Most single-family homes in the United States with central air use a split system. This suggests that the device is divided into 2 parts: an evaporator coil within a compressor and the home outside.

Your specialist will assist you in identifying the appropriate size main air conditioner for your home. A system that is too little will run practically continuously, whereas a unit that is too big will chill the home too rapidly and turn off prior to completing a full cycle.
The fast on/off in the latter scenario is taxing on the system. It can cause the evaporator coil to freeze, and a frozen coil avoids air from streaming. As a outcome, a big a/c might be less reliable at cooling than a smaller system.
Your Air Conditioner installation will do a calculation called a “Manual-J” to identify finest system for your home. This will take into consideration all of the specifications we’ve discussed and more, leading to the most exact size possible.
We comprehend that many house owners like to have a basic idea of what size they require ahead of time. central air conditioning conditioner size: To get the Btu needed, increase the square footage of your house’s conditioned area by 25, then divide by 12,000 to get the tonnage.

Rates vary based on the regional market and the task details, as with any significant job. For labor and products, a normal split system central air installation using an existing furnace could cost between $3,000 and $7,000 or more. Usually, that expense will be divided around 60/40, with labor accounting for majority of it.
